Moment of inertia: a cross-sectional parameter describing the distribution of the cross-sectional area relative to a given axis of analysis.
The farther the area is located from the axis (e.g. in an I-beam), the greater the moment of inertia.
The moment of inertia is used in the calculation of normal stresses due to bending, shear stresses due to shear (Żurawski formula), and displacements.
